Product Overview and Core Design
The SmartCara PCS750 is a countertop electric compost bin that processes food scraps through controlled heat, airflow, and agitation. Its goal is volume reduction rather than producing finished garden compost. Because of this, the PCS750 is best understood as a food waste processor rather than a traditional composter.
The unit features a sealed processing chamber, an internal mixing paddle, and an integrated carbon-based filtration system. Together, these components reduce moisture, limit odors, and break down food waste into a dry, soil-like output. As a result, users can store kitchen scraps daily without dealing with pests or smells.

Installation and Initial Setup
Installation of the SmartCara PCS750 is straightforward because the unit arrives fully assembled. First, place the bin on a stable, heat-resistant countertop with adequate clearance around ventilation openings. This spacing is essential because airflow supports internal drying and odor control.
Next, connect the power cord directly to a grounded outlet. Avoid extension cords, as they can interfere with power stability. Once powered, the control interface activates automatically, allowing the unit to begin its default processing cycle. Before adding waste, ensure the internal bucket is properly seated, since misalignment can prevent the lid from sealing correctly.
Operational Adjustment and Daily Use
During daily operation, the PCS750 accepts most food scraps, including fruit peels, vegetable trimmings, grains, and small amounts of cooked food. However, adding waste gradually improves performance. Overloading the chamber can slow drying and increase cycle time.
The internal paddle rotates intermittently to agitate waste. Because of this, food should be evenly distributed rather than packed tightly. Moisture-heavy scraps, such as melon rinds, benefit from being mixed with drier materials to improve processing balance.
Routine Maintenance and Cleaning
Regular maintenance ensures consistent odor control and efficient processing. After each processing cycle, the output container should be emptied and wiped clean. Residual buildup can harden if left unattended.
Weekly cleaning with mild soap prevents residue from forming on the paddle and chamber walls. In addition, the carbon filter requires periodic inspection. When odors persist despite normal operation, replacing the filter restores proper airflow and filtration efficiency.
Troubleshooting Common Setup Issues
If the SmartCara PCS750 fails to start, the most common cause is an improperly seated lid or bucket. The safety interlock prevents operation when alignment is incorrect. Repositioning the components usually resolves this issue quickly.
Persistent moisture in the finished output often indicates excessive wet waste. Reducing load size or extending processing time improves drying. Similarly, unusual noise typically results from oversized food scraps interfering with the paddle, which can be corrected by cutting waste into smaller pieces.
Customization and Performance Optimization
Although the PCS750 offers limited manual controls, users can optimize performance through input management. Balancing wet and dry scraps improves drying speed. Avoiding fibrous materials, such as corn husks, reduces strain on the mixing mechanism.
Odor control improves when the lid remains closed between waste additions. This practice stabilizes internal airflow and prevents sudden moisture changes. Over time, consistent input habits produce more predictable processing cycles.
Compatibility With Composting Accessories
The SmartCara PCS750 does not require compostable bags, and using them is not recommended. Bags can interfere with agitation and airflow. Instead, scraps should be added directly to the internal bucket.
Carbon replacement filters designed specifically for the PCS750 maintain odor control and should not be substituted with generic alternatives. Countertop scrap caddies can be used alongside the PCS750 for temporary storage, but contents should be transferred daily to avoid excess moisture accumulation.
Comparison With Similar Electric Compost Bins
Compared to other electric compost bins, the PCS750 emphasizes odor containment and safety over speed. Some competing units process waste faster but generate more heat and noise. The PCS750 operates more quietly, which makes it suitable for open kitchen layouts.
However, it has a smaller processing capacity than larger electric models. As a result, it suits small to medium households rather than high-volume food waste producers. Its enclosed design and conservative processing cycles prioritize reliability and longevity.
